Greedy algorithm dynamic programming
WebJun 10, 2024 · Dynamic Programming: It is a technique that divides problems into smaller ones, and then saves the result so that it does not have to be recalculated in the future. ... Greedy Algorithms are ... WebNov 29, 2024 · Greedy algorithms can be quite successful, but they have some significant flaws. ... In Brief, Dynamic Programming is a general, powerful algorithm design technique (for things like shortest path ...
Greedy algorithm dynamic programming
Did you know?
WebAlgorithm 轮渡装载问题,algorithm,dynamic-programming,greedy,Algorithm,Dynamic Programming,Greedy,我对下面提到的算法问题有困难: 一个港口有一艘三线制渡轮,渡轮前面排着一队N 车辆。它们每个都有指定的长度,单位为厘米。我们也知道 轮渡的长 … http://duoduokou.com/algorithm/50808975798101385987.html
http://duoduokou.com/algorithm/32775369126584527408.html http://duoduokou.com/algorithm/50867821092277819463.html
WebFeb 18, 2024 · In Greedy Algorithm a set of resources are recursively divided based on the maximum, immediate availability of that resource at any given stage of execution. To solve a problem based on the greedy approach, there are … WebNov 5, 2024 · A good programmer uses all these techniques based on the type of problem. In this blog post, I am going to cover 2 fundamental algorithm design principles: greedy algorithms and dynamic programming. GREEDY ALGORITHM. A greedy algorithm, …
WebExplanation: A greedy algorithm gives optimal solution for all subproblems, but when these locally optimal solutions are combined it may NOT result into a globally optimal solution. Hence, a greedy algorithm CANNOT be used to …
WebMay 23, 2024 · The algorithm itself does not have a good sense of direction as to which way will get you to place B faster. The optimal decisions are not made greedily, but are made by exhausting all possible routes that can make a distance shorter. Therefore, it's a dynamic programming algorithm, the only variation being that the stages are not … how late does dhl express deliverWebGreedy Algorithms vs Dynamic Programming. Greedy Algorithms are similar to dynamic programming in the sense that they are both tools for optimization. However, greedy algorithms look for locally optimum solutions or in other words, a greedy … how late does hardee\u0027s serve breakfastWebFor greedy algorithms, given that there is no need to revisit or modify earlier solutions or values, it is memory-efficient. A greedy algorithm never revisits or modifies the prior values or solutions when computing the solution. Generally speaking, they are quicker than … how late does dq serve the 5 lunchWebAlgorithm 深入理解算法设计技术,algorithm,dynamic-programming,backtracking,greedy,divide-and-conquer,Algorithm,Dynamic Programming,Backtracking,Greedy,Divide And Conquer,“为给定的应用程序设计正确的 … how late does dunkin donuts serve breakfasthttp://duoduokou.com/algorithm/34714736242759340908.html how late does frisch\u0027s serve breakfastWebAlgorithm 深入理解算法设计技术,algorithm,dynamic-programming,backtracking,greedy,divide-and-conquer,Algorithm,Dynamic Programming,Backtracking,Greedy,Divide And Conquer,“为给定的应用程序设计正确的算法是一项困难的工作。 how late does fedex workWebNov 4, 2024 · Dynamic programming requires more memory as it stores the solution of each and every possible sub problems in the table. It does lot of work compared to greedy approach, but optimal solution is ensured. In following table, we have compared … how late does fedex smartpost deliver